Germany is known as the industrial powerhouse of Europe, with world-leading companies in automotive, machinery, and engineering sectors.
There is a consistent demand for skilled professionals due to technological advancements and an aging workforce.
Employees in this sector often receive competitive wages, job security, and social benefits like health insurance and retirement plans.
Germany invests heavily in Industry 4.0, automation, and digital manufacturing, offering exposure to cutting-edge technology.
Experience in German manufacturing opens doors to global roles, given the international reputation of German engineering and production standards.
Germany offers structured vocational training and apprenticeship programs (e.g., Duale Ausbildung) that blend theory and practical skills.
A stable political and economic environment makes Germany an attractive destination for long-term career growth in production and manufacturing.
Germany’s manufacturing sector is not just about mass production—it thrives on precision, customization, and innovation, offering international professionals a space to contribute creatively.
With a strong focus on automation, robotics, and smart manufacturing, Germany invites skilled international workers to participate in advanced, future-ready production environments.
From large industrial players to mid-sized “Mittelstand” firms, Germany offers a variety of workplaces that value fresh perspectives and global talent.
Germany’s emphasis on continual learning allows international employees to grow through hands-on training, technical workshops, and professional certifications.
Germany actively seeks international talent in shortage occupations, including manufacturing and engineering, making visa and relocation processes more accessible.
Working in Germany connects international candidates to global supply chains and cross-cultural teams, enhancing both technical and interpersonal skills.
Creative manufacturing in Germany includes sustainable production methods, eco-friendly design, and innovation in materials—ideal for professionals passionate about impact and aesthetics.

Eligibility Criteria |
Details |
|---|---|
|
Work Visa / Residence Permit |
Required. Most non-EU applicants need a valid work visa or Blue Card. |
|
Recognized Qualifications |
A degree, diploma, or vocational qualification recognized in Germany. |
|
Relevant Work Experience |
2–5 years preferred for technical or managerial roles; not mandatory for entry-level. |
|
German Language Skills |
A2–B1 level often preferred (mandatory for vocational roles); English may suffice in some international firms. |
|
Job Offer from German Employer |
Required for visa application. Must meet salary threshold (varies by job type). |
|
Skilled Occupation Listing |
Job must fall under Germany’s shortage occupation list (includes many manufacturing jobs). |
|
Educational Equivalency |
Foreign qualifications must be evaluated by ZAB (Central Office for Foreign Education). |
|
Proof of Funds (if applicable) |
Required for some visa categories until first salary is received. |
|
Clean Criminal Record |
May be requested during visa/residence permit application. |
|
Medical Insurance |
Must have valid health insurance (public or private) in Germany. |

Visa Type |
Who It's For |
Key Requirements |
Benefits |
|---|---|---|---|
|
EU Blue Card |
University graduates with a recognized degree and a job offer in a skilled field |
Recognized degree (ZAB equivalency) |
Fast-track residency, family reunification, path to permanent residency |
|
Skilled Workers Visa |
Applicants with vocational qualifications (e.g. mechatronics, CNC, welding) |
Recognized vocational training |
Long-term residence, access to German labor market |
|
Job Seeker Visa |
Qualified professionals looking for jobs in Germany |
Degree/vocational training |
Stay up to 6 months to find a job, convert to work visa upon employment |
|
Work Visa (General) |
For roles not covered by Blue Card/Skilled Work Visa |
Job offer |
Suitable for mid-skill roles (assembly, packaging, logistics) |
|
ICT Card (Intra-Company Transfer) |
Employees of multinational companies transferred to German branches |
Internal transfer by employer |
For temporary relocation to Germany (up to 3 years) |
|
Apprenticeship Visa (Ausbildung) |
Young candidates pursuing vocational training in Germany |
Admission to a recognized apprenticeship program |
Leads to permanent work opportunities in skilled manufacturing roles |
|
Recognition Visa (Anerkennungsvisum) |
For skilled workers whose qualifications need recognition before employment |
Foreign qualification |
Can lead to full-time work visa after successful recognition |
